The holiday season is a good time for innovation. The traditional activities that surround Christmas—family dinners—and their ingredients can be used as a source of inspiration. Those creamy mash potatoes in their rawer form not only serve as a derivative to binders such as maltodextrin, they may offer anti-aging benefits and possibly reduce skin irritation.
